In this review of the Front Brake Pad & Rotor Kit Ceramic compatible with 2016-2018 Ford Explorer, the bottom line is clear: this kit is aimed at DIY owners and independent mechanics who want a full front-end brake refresh with direct-fit components. It stands out because it includes pads, rotors, calipers, and hoses in one package, simplifying parts sourcing and reducing installation time. The kit's ceramic pads and G3000 casting alloy rotors promise quieter operation and reduced dust, making it a practical option for drivers who value easy installation and clean-running brakes.
Key Features
- Complete kit: Includes front ceramic pad set, two rotors, two calipers, and two replacement brake hoses so installers get everything needed for a front brake job in one purchase.
- Ceramic brake pads: Positive molded ceramic friction material minimizes dust and helps keep wheels cleaner compared with semi-metallic pads.
- G3000 casting alloy rotors: The rotors are designed for reduced noise and improved wear resistance for longer service life under normal driving.
- Application specific design: Direct-fit components are made to match the original equipment envelope to avoid modifications and speed up installation.
- Pre-assembled convenience: Pre-pressed components and assembled calipers reduce bench work and make the swap faster for DIY mechanics.
Who It's For
This kit is best for owners of 2016-2018 Ford Explorer models with standard duty front brakes who need a full front-end brake replacement and prefer buying a matched set rather than sourcing individual parts. It suits DIY enthusiasts who want an easier installation thanks to direct-fit parts and pre-assembled items, and small shops that handle routine brake jobs and value consistent fit and fewer missing pieces.
Those who should look elsewhere include drivers seeking high-performance track-grade pads or rotors tuned for extreme heat cycles, and anyone whose vehicle uses heavy-duty or nonstandard brake packages, since this kit is specified for standard duty front brakes only.

Specifications
| Fitment | 2016-2018 Ford Explorer front (standard duty) |
| Kit contents | Front ceramic pad set, 2 front rotors, 2 front calipers, 2 brake hoses |
| Brake pad material | Ceramic (positive molded) |
| Rotor material | G3000 casting alloy |
| Design | Application specific direct-fit, pre-assembled components |
| Compatibility note | For standard duty front brake Explorer models (2016-2018) |
